Wish I could help with hotels Vin but I havent stayed at any near the airport. But you are better off(rate wise) somewhere outside the City like Brisbane(near airport), there are very few discount hotels in SF or near Fisherman's Wharf. You can then rent a car or take a taxi into the City for dinner or whatever. :tu Will you have time for a smoke? :sh
